The franchise fee of $49,500 is approximately 24% higher than the typical range for fast casual restaurants. What specific additional services, training, or support justify this premium pricing compared to competitors?
#1
Three litigation cases have been initiated against the franchisor in the past 3 years with 2 pending. What are the nature and status of these pending cases, and have any resulted in settlements or judgments against the franchisor?
#2
The non-compete clause restricts former franchisees from competing for 2 years within 15 miles of any existing location. Given your 80-unit footprint, how would this restriction impact a franchisee's ability to operate a different concept after exit in most geographic markets?
#3
You experienced 151.98% unit growth over 3 years (5 to 80 units). What percentage of this growth came from new franchisees versus acquisitions or conversions of existing units?
#4
Eight units were transferred in 2024 (10.0% of the system). How many of these transfers were due to franchisee dissatisfaction versus organic ownership transitions, and what was the average time between unit opening and transfer?
#5
Your franchise agreement requires personal guarantees from owners with 10% or greater interest and their spouses. Are there any circumstances under which this personal guarantee can be released or modified during the franchise term?
#6
The agreement requires binding arbitration in Placer County, California and prohibits class action lawsuits. Has the franchisor pursued any arbitration claims against franchisees, and what was the outcome?
#7
You have 6 types of curable defaults with a 30-day cure period for franchisees, while the franchisor receives a 60-day cure period. Can you provide examples of defaults the franchisor has cured under this clause and the timeline involved?
#8
Renewal requires complete refurbishment, remodeling, and redecorating at franchisee expense. What is the estimated cost range for these renewal requirements, and can you provide examples of what this entails?
#9
Franchisees must purchase all products from franchisor-approved suppliers across 8 different categories. What is the markup or profit margin the franchisor receives from supplier relationships, and are there alternative supplier options if a franchisee finds better pricing?
#10
How many franchisees have elected not to renew at the end of their 10-year initial term, and what were the primary reasons cited for non-renewal?
#11
The transfer fee is $10,000 and renewal fee is also $10,000. Are these fees refundable in any circumstances, and do they apply in addition to any other franchisor fees during renewal or transfer?
#12
Item 19 financial performance data is available. Can you provide the median unit volume, average unit volume, and ranges for the past 2-3 years, broken down by unit age or geography if available?
#13
What is the average franchisee investment required beyond the $49,500 franchise fee (equipment, buildout, working capital, etc.), and what percentage of franchisees achieve profitability within the first year?
#14
The franchisor has encroachment protection but territories are not exclusive. How is encroachment defined, what triggers franchisor action, and have there been any disputes with franchisees regarding encroachment?
#15
With 80 units and 26.98% growth last year, what are your projections for unit growth over the next 3-5 years, and how might rapid expansion affect franchisee unit economics?
#16
Are there any material terms of the franchise agreement that have been modified or waived for any franchisees, and would those modifications be available to new franchisees?
#17
What percentage of your current 80 units are profitable, and how many have underperformed below initial projections? What support does the franchisor provide to struggling locations?
#18
The non-compete restricts competing concepts broadly. Can you define specifically what constitutes a competing business under your interpretation?
#19
Given the 3 pending litigation cases, what is the nature of these disputes (franchisee-initiated, supplier-related, employee claims, etc.), and what is the expected timeline for resolution?
